Detail: A recent professional profile photo is to accompany your application EMPLOYMENT TYPE : Permanent SECTOR : Finance BASIC SALARY : Market related START DATE : A.S.A.P REQUIREMENTS: Grade 12 (Matric) with Accounting and/or Mathematics. A National Diploma or Certificate in Accounting, Bookkeeping, or Financial Management will be advantageous. 1–3 years of experience in a junior finance, bookkeeping, or accounts payable role. Hands-on experience using Sage Pastel, including capturing invoices, processing journals, and navigating the system. Practical working knowledge of Microsoft Excel, including data entry, basic formulas, sorting, filtering, and preparing reconciliation sheets. Strong numerical accuracy and attention to detail when capturing and processing financial data. Meticulous accuracy when reviewing invoices, verifying information, and processing financial figures. Ability to manage workload effectively, meet weekly and monthly payment deadlines, and maintain accurate and well-organized records. Professional verbal and written communication skills when liaising with vendors, suppliers, and colleagues. High level of reliability, confidentiality, and integrity when handling sensitive financial information. DUTIES: Invoice Capturing & Accounts Payable (Sage Pastel): Capture and process all creditor and supplier invoices accurately into Sage Pastel. Cross-reference invoices with purchase orders, delivery notes, and supervisor approvals prior to processing. Follow up on pricing discrepancies, missing information, or unauthorized charges with suppliers and internal teams. Maintain an organized physical and electronic filing system for all invoices and financial records. Supplier Reconciliations & Payments (Excel & Sage): Reconcile monthly supplier statements against Sage Pastel ledgers using Excel. Prepare monthly payment schedules and compile remittance advices for supplier payment runs. Handle supplier queries regarding payment status, statement balances, and invoices in a professional manner. Petty Cash & Expense Management: Capture and process staff expense claims and petty cash slips into Sage Pastel, ensuring all receipts are attached and valid. Track and reconcile petty cash floats using structured Excel templates. General Financial Support: Assist the Finance Manager with month-end adjustments and journal entries in Sage Pastel. Extract ledger reports and export transaction summaries from Sage into Excel for review. Assist with gathering invoices and schedules required for internal or external audits.
